The Legacy of Tron: A Cyberpunk Dream

To truly appreciate the weight on Jared Leto's shoulders, we need to take a quick trip down memory lane. The original Tron (1982) was a visual spectacle that blew audiences away with its innovative use of CGI, thrusting viewers into a digital world unlike anything they had ever seen. Then came Tron: Legacy (2010), which amplified the visual grandeur with stunning aesthetics and a killer soundtrack by Daft Punk, expanding the lore and introducing new characters while paying homage to the original. These films weren't just movies; they were cultural moments that shaped the sci-fi landscape. Tron established a unique blend of cyberpunk, action, and philosophical themes, exploring the relationship between humans and technology in a way that was both thought-provoking and visually captivating. The light cycles, the identity discs, the Grid – these elements became instantly recognizable and deeply ingrained in pop culture. Jared Leto: A Controversial Choice?

Now, let's get to the heart of the matter: Jared Leto. The dude is undeniably talented, with an Oscar under his belt and a reputation for intense method acting. However, his casting in Tron: Ares has been met with mixed reactions. Some fans are stoked to see what he brings to the table, while others are... well, let's just say they're skeptical. Why the controversy? Leto's past roles have been a bit of a mixed bag. He's delivered some truly amazing performances, like his portrayal of Rayon in Dallas Buyers Club, which earned him critical acclaim and an Academy Award. But he's also had his share of misses, with some fans criticizing his take on the Joker in Suicide Squad. This inconsistency has led to concerns about whether he can truly capture the essence of the Tron universe. Another factor contributing to the skepticism is Leto's public persona. He's known for being eccentric and sometimes controversial, which can overshadow his work. Some fans worry that his personal brand might clash with the established tone of Tron, potentially distracting from the story. What We Know About Tron: Ares (So Far)

Okay, so what do we actually know about Tron: Ares? Details have been pretty scarce, but here's the gist: the movie is expected to explore new areas of the Tron universe, diving deeper into the concepts of AI and virtual reality. The plot is rumored to center around Ares, a program (presumably played by Jared Leto) who crosses over into the human world, bringing with him the dangers and possibilities of the Grid. This premise opens up a ton of exciting possibilities. We could see stunning new visuals, mind-bending action sequences, and thought-provoking explorations of what it means to be human in an increasingly digital world. The film is being directed by Joachim Rønning, known for his work on Pirates of the Caribbean: Dead Men Tell No Tales and Maleficent: Mistress of Evil. Rønning's experience with visual spectacle and fantasy worlds could be a good fit for the Tron franchise. However, some fans are concerned about his ability to capture the unique tone and philosophical depth of the original films. The cast also includes Greta Lee, Evan Peters, Hasan Minhaj, Jodie Turner-Smith, and Sarah Desjardins, adding a mix of established talent and fresh faces to the Tron universe. Their roles are still under wraps, but their presence suggests that Tron: Ares will feature a diverse ensemble cast with potentially compelling storylines.
